Frequently Asked Questions about Costa Mesa
How much are Studio apartments in Costa Mesa?
There are currently 577 Studio Apartments in Costa Mesa with rent ranges from $1,500 to $4,130 with an average price of $2,553.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Costa Mesa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Costa Mesa ranges from $1,508 to $8,200 with an average monthly rent of $3,186.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Costa Mesa c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Costa Mesa range from $2,450 to $10,617.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,017.
How expensive are Costa Mesa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 354 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Costa Mesa on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,348 to $20,000 - averaging $6,424 for the location.
